How to Get IBM Courses For Free?
here are several legitimate ways to access IBM courses for free. IBM and its partners offer a range of free learning resources—whether you’re looking to boost your technical skills, earn digital badges, or prepare for certification. Here are some methods to get started:
1. IBM Skills Network (Cognitive Class)
IBM Skills Network (formerly known as Cognitive Class) is one of the primary ways to access free IBM courses.
- Free Courses and Digital Badges:
- Visit the IBM Skills Network website.
- Enroll in courses covering topics like data science, machine learning, artificial intelligence, cloud computing, and more.
- Complete the modules, pass the quizzes, and earn digital badges or certificates at no cost.
- Self-Paced Learning:
- All courses are self-paced, allowing you to learn on your schedule.
- The courses are designed with hands-on labs and real-world scenarios to build practical skills.
2. IBM SkillsBuild
IBM SkillsBuild is another free platform designed to help learners develop digital and professional skills, often with a focus on emerging technologies and workforce readiness.
- Access Learning Paths:
- Visit the IBM SkillsBuild website and create a free account.
- Explore various learning paths, projects, and courses that are entirely free.
- Earn Digital Certificates:
- Many courses within SkillsBuild offer certificates or digital badges upon successful completion.
- These credentials can be shared on your LinkedIn profile or included in your resume.
3. IBM Developer and IBM Training
IBM Developer and IBM Training are platforms that provide free tutorials, documentation, and learning materials.
- IBM Developer Resources:
- Visit IBM Developer.
- Access free tutorials, code patterns, and learning labs across a range of topics, including AI, blockchain, cloud, and more.
- IBM Training Portal:
- Explore free courses and webinars on the IBM Training website.
- Look for special initiatives or promotions that offer complimentary access to selected training materials.
4. Free Trials on Partner Platforms
IBM partners with major online learning platforms like Coursera and edX to deliver professional certificate programs. Although many of these courses require payment, you can often access them for free by:
- Financial Aid and Scholarships:
- Apply for financial aid on platforms such as Coursera for IBM professional certificates (e.g., IBM Data Science Professional Certificate).
- Check edX for IBM courses that offer audit options or financial assistance so you can learn without paying.
- Free Audit Options:
- Many courses allow you to audit the content for free. While auditing usually doesn’t include a verified certificate, you can still benefit from the learning materials at no cost.
